** The Mercedes-Benz repair market for residents of Prairie, Mississippi, is reliant on the surrounding regional hubs, primarily Tupelo. There are no dedicated Mercedes-Benz specialists physically located within the small city of Prairie itself. The market in the broader region is characterized by a handful of highly competent independent shops that compete directly with the nearest Mercedes-Benz dealerships, which are located in Memphis, TN (~100 miles away) and Birmingham, AL (~120 miles away). The **average quality** of the independent specialists is notably high, as they must maintain expert-level knowledge to service the complex systems of modern Mercedes-Benz vehicles and retain a discerning clientele. **Competition** is moderate but specialized; these shops do not compete with general mechanics but rather with each other and the distance-inconvenience of the authorized dealerships. **Typical pricing** is premium, reflecting the required expertise, proprietary tools, and high-cost parts, but it is generally 20-35% lower than dealership labor rates, providing significant value. For a resident of Prairie, the choice often comes down to the specific specialization required (e.g., AMG performance vs. classic chassis repair) and the preferred drive to either Tupelo or Columbus.
